Alexey Shved and Josh Howard combined for 33 points for Minnesota Tuesday and the Timberwolves won for the third time in four games, 105-88 over Philadelphia. Shved put in 17 points, Howard added 16 and J.J. Barea supplied 11. Also reaching double figures for the T'Wolves were Derrick Williams, Luke Ridnour and Malcolm Lee with 10 each. Evan Turner led the 76ers with 19 points and Jrue Holiday had 13 to go with nine assists in Philadelphia's second consecutive setback following three straight victories.
